Demon Hound (地獄の番犬, Jigoku no Banken) is an enemy which appears in Suikoden.

Demon Hound are quite powerful like the rest of the enemies you'll encounter in Kalekka but if the party is at a relatively comparative level, they should pose little problem save for whittling down your HP in multiple battles. They are completely immune to fire magic and as such fire spells will always do 0 damage.

Information

The Demon Hound is a double-headed monster that was spotted in the ruins of Kalekka. Its entire body is bathed in pale blue flames, making it immune to fire magic as well as difficult to fight off. It had a weakness to earth and water magic, though this did little to reduce its danger.

Trivia

  • Demon Hound's Japanese name translates as Hellhound while the Hell Hound enemy's Japanese name is something different entirely: Jackal.
